This Saint is the Patron Saints of orphans, grieving parents and widows. She was left a widow after his husband died of tuberculosis and left to take care of their 4 children alone and became completely dependent on the kindness of strangers. She would eventually convert and become Catholic and would found the Sisters of Charity and start the first Catholic schools for girls in Baltimore. She would become the first American-born canonized saint.
Who is St. Elizabeth Ann Seton?

This Saint is the Patron Saint of France, soldiers, martyrs and women in the military. She received visions of saints who told her to lead France in driving the English out from France. After leading a series of victories she was betrayed and handed over to the British who martyred her on claims of heresy.
Who is St. Joan of Arc?
